Transaction 22a17b73d55d6c8cc2d295dd8c908633c5426474451ae61ec30d89b4661eb11e

1 Input
2 Outputs
  • 22a17b73d55d6c8cc2d295dd8c908633c5426474451ae61ec30d89b4661eb11e:0
  • value  15063
    address  34wjPbsE1du4utYCL8ggS5snfT4SAYTZRE
  • 22a17b73d55d6c8cc2d295dd8c908633c5426474451ae61ec30d89b4661eb11e:1
  • value  43662
    address  1KzUYGrzjEExniXe6MZKTdm8SUQ1RrCUXS